URL Structure
https://api.memegen.link/images/{template}/{top_text}/{bottom_text}.png
Example: https://api.memegen.link/images/buzz/memes/memes_everywhere.png renders Buzz Lightyear with "memes" / "memes everywhere".
Text Encoding
| Character | Encoding |
|---|---|
| Space | _ or - |
| Newline | ~n |
| Question mark | ~q |
| Percent | ~p |
| Slash | ~s |
| Hash | ~h |
| Single quote | '' |
| Double quote | "" |
Template Selection Guide
| Context | Template | Format |
|---|---|---|
| Comparing options | drake | Two-panel reject/approve |
| Celebrating wins | success | Success Kid |
| Problems being ignored | fine | Ironic "this is fine" |
| Uncertainty | fry | "Not sure if X or Y" |
| Hot take | changemind | Statement + "change my mind" |
| Ubiquitous things | buzz | "X, X everywhere" |
| Bad ideas | mordor | "One does not simply..." |
| Split priorities | distracted | Distracted boyfriend (3 texts) |
| Rare admissions | interesting | "I don't always X, but when I do" |
| Recursion jokes | yodawg | "Yo dawg, I heard you like X" |
More than 100 templates exist; if unsure a template id is valid, stick to the well-known ones above rather than guessing.

Writing Good Meme Text
- Keep it short: 2-6 words per line; long text becomes unreadable
- Match template to the message -- the format IS half the joke
- Encode every special character or the URL breaks
- Always include the file extension
Text-Based Memes
When an image doesn't fit, offer text formats directly in the reply: greentext stories (> be me), copypasta parodies, "nobody: / me:" formats, ASCII art reactions, or fake dialogue screenshots written as quoted exchanges. Same rule applies: brevity and format-fit make the joke.
